Output 616758de51130512c949eed319fed1aa16b304c0ead5d93fbf149bfc38f23eb1:0

value
19945760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74d41dd5cd5ec9c781697dfccda174b5d39fd1dd OP_EQUALVERIFY OP_CHECKSIG
address
1BejVNMUYb1kqwkWS83ecNVukfNmjHJWEi
transaction
616758de51130512c949eed319fed1aa16b304c0ead5d93fbf149bfc38f23eb1
spent
true